Deputy Senate President Loses Police Aide In Accident

The Deputy President of the Senate, Senator Barau Jibrin, has mourned the death of one of his drivers, Corporal Barde Nuhu, who died in an accident while on his way to visit his family in Niger State.

Barde died on Saturday in a car accident while travelling to Shata village in Bosso local government area of Niger State.

Senator Barau, in a statement by his media aide, Ismail Mudashir, on Sunday, said the late driver was a dedicated and committed police officer who discharged his duties diligently to the best of his ability.

Senator Barau extended his condolences to Barde’s immediate family and the Nigeria Police Force (NPF) over the loss.

“With a heavy heart but total submission to the will of Allah SWT, I mourn the passing of CPL Barde Nuhu, who died in a car accident while on his way to Bosso LGA in Niger State. He was a hardworking, dedicated and committed Police officer. May Allah SWT grant him Jannatul Firdausi,” he said.

On Sunday, Senator Barau sent a high-powered delegation to Shata, the hometown of the deceased police officer in Boso LGA, Niger State, for a condolence visit.

The delegation, led by Senator Barau’s Aide De Camp, SP Abdulrahman Baba Garba, commiserated with the family of the late police corporal.

The delegation met the wife, children and parents of the late police officer. During the visit, prayers were offered for the repose of the Police officer.

“The deputy president of the Senate donated money to support the family of the late police officer,” the statement added.
